diff --git a/src/db/migration/V20170526_1329__mantis9036.sql b/src/db/migration/V20170526_1329__mantis9036.sql index 167e827d4..4d5b983f1 100644 --- a/src/db/migration/V20170526_1329__mantis9036.sql +++ b/src/db/migration/V20170526_1329__mantis9036.sql @@ -1,4 +1,4 @@ -CREATE OR REPLACE FUNCTION "FN_ARREDONDAMENTO_TARIFA"(pTarifa IN NUMBER, +create or replace FUNCTION "FN_ARREDONDAMENTO_TARIFA"(pTarifa IN NUMBER, pOrgaoConcedenteId IN NUMBER, pImporteSeguro IN NUMBER, pImporteTaxaEmbarque IN NUMBER, @@ -134,7 +134,7 @@ CREATE OR REPLACE FUNCTION "FN_ARREDONDAMENTO_TARIFA"(pTarifa IN NU END IF; END IF; - IF pOrgaoConcedenteId= 22 + IF pOrgaoConcedenteId = 22 THEN lStrPrecoTotal := to_char(lPrecoTotal, '99999.9999'); lStrAntePenlultimoNumero := substr(lStrPrecoTotal, -4, 1); @@ -153,7 +153,7 @@ CREATE OR REPLACE FUNCTION "FN_ARREDONDAMENTO_TARIFA"(pTarifa IN NU IF lTresUltimos BETWEEN 755 AND 999 THEN lPrecoTotallArredondado := - to_number(lStrParteInteira || '.' || lStrAntePenlultimoNumero || '000', '99999.999') + 0.1; + to_number(lStrParteInteira || '.' || lStrAntePenlultimoNumero || '000', '99999.9999') + 0.1; END IF; END IF;